The Bachelor of Community Development qualification offered on the Qwaqwa Campus develops young professionals who are able to work collaboratively with the community to come up with initiatives that build resilience and sustainability. Before obtaining their qualifications, students are required to identify community needs and to come up with viable ways to eradicate these.

It was during this period that Mpho Twala, a recent CommDev graduate, identified a once-thriving community vegetable garden that had been abandoned and subsequently stripped over the years. Further research led her to realise that the soil was still very fertile, and with a bit of work, could once again be revived to become an income-generating business. She received her qualification during the April graduations on the Qwaqwa Campus, but she did not stop there.

Bringing change to the community through vegetable farming

Twala, with no agricultural background, approached the locals for permission to revive the 1-ha garden into a community-owned vegetable garden. “The land has been uncultivated for more than a decade, and after conducting a needs analysis, I didn’t want to leave it like that, because I saw that if I worked with young people, this would help with the high unemployment rate among the youth in this area,” Twala said.

She says she was driven by bringing about change in her community, which she believes was inspired by her studies.
“I’ve always wanted to do something in my community, and CommDev taught me to see opportunities instead of challenges.”

The vegetable garden currently has 17 employees, 10 of whom are under the age of 35. They are currently harvesting cabbages, various forms of spinach, and white onion – all organic – for home consumption and community purchasing. They also occasionally sell to hawkers around Qwaqwa.

Twala dreams of expanding the garden, adding more crops, and ultimately reaching commercial level. “We are currently classified under subsistence farming – farming for home consumption and selling the surplus so that the project can remain operational. But with the right funding and support, we can grow bigger and better.”

Sunflowers are satellite dishes for sunshine, or are they?
2016-07-20

Eighty-six percent of South Africa’s
sunflowers are produced in the
Free State and North West provinces.

Helen Mirren, the English actress, said “the sunflower is like a satellite dish for sunshine”. However, researchers at the University of the Free State (UFS) have found that too much of this sunshine could have a negative effect on the growth of sunflowers, which are a major source of oil in South Africa.

According to Dr Gert Ceronio from the Department of Soil, Crop, and Climate Sciences at the UFS, extremely high soil temperatures play a definite role in the sprouting of sunflower seedlings. Together with Lize Henning, professional officer in the department, and Dr André Nel from the Agricultural Research Council, he is doing research on biotic and abiotic factors that could have an impact on sunflowers.

Impact of high temperatures on sunflower production

The Free State and North West provinces, which produce 86% of South Africa’s sunflowers, are afflicted especially by high summer temperatures that lead to extremely high soil temperatures.

Dr Ceronio says: “Although sunflower seeds are able to germinate at temperatures from as low as 4°C to as high as 41°C, soil temperatures of 35°C and higher could have a negative effect on the vegetative faculty of sunflower seedlings, and could have an adverse effect on the percentage of sunflowers that germinate. From the end of November until mid-January, this is a common phenomenon in the sandy soil of the Free State and North West provinces. Soil temperatures can easily exceed the critical temperature of 43°C, which can lead to poor germination and even the replanting of sunflowers.”

Since temperature have a huge impact not only on the germination of sunflower seeds, but also on the vegetative faculty and sprouting of sunflower seedlings, Dr Ceronio suggests that sunflowers should be planted in soil with soil temperatures of 22 to 30°C. Planting is usually done in October and early November. Unfortunately, this is not always possible, as soil moisture is not optimal for growth. Farmers are then compelled to plant sunflowers later.

Impact of herbicides on sunflower growth

“High soil temperatures, combined with the herbicide sensitivity of some cultivars, could lead to the poor development of seedlings," says Dr Ceronio.

The use of herbicides, such as ALACHLOR, for the control of weeds in sunflowers is common practice in sunflower production. It has already been determined that ALACHLOR could still have a damaging effect on the seedlings of some cultivars during germination and sprouting, even at recommended application dosages.

“The purpose of the continued research is to establish the sensitivity of sunflower cultivars to ALACHLOR when exposed to high soil temperatures,” says Dr Ceronio.
